Rainbow Trout
Opportunities for Rainbow Trout near Pottawattamie Park, Indiana, are primarily found in the state's stocked lakes and streams. While not a natural habitat, the Indiana DNR stocks trout in select locations to provide recreational fishing. Spring and fall are the best times to target these fish, coinciding with stocking periods and cooler water temperatures. Check the DNR's stocking reports to identify recently stocked locations. PowerBait, small spinners, and live worms are common and effective baits. Many stocked locations offer easy access from the bank, making it a great option for beginners. Be aware that these areas can get crowded, especially soon after stocking, so arrive early to secure a good spot. Rainbows are typically stocked at a catchable size, providing a fun and accessible fishing experience for all skill levels.

Rainbow Trout Fishing Regulations in Indiana
Open Season
Year-round
Daily Bag Limit
5 per day
Size Limit
No size limit
License Required
Freshwater fishing license
In streams, rivers, and Lake Michigan, the bag limit is 5 trout per day with no more than 1 being a brown trout. Some streams are stocked with trout and have special regulations.
⚠️ Always verify current regulations with the Indiana state wildlife agency before fishing.

Frequently Asked Questions
What's the best way to catch rainbow trout in Pottawattamie Park?
Try using small spinners, worms, or powerbait. Focus on areas with moving water or near structure.
What is the daily limit for rainbow trout in Pottawattamie Park, Indiana?
The daily bag limit for rainbow trout in Indiana is 5 fish. Be sure to check for any local regulations that may differ.
Is there a size limit for rainbow trout in Indiana?
No, there is no size limit for rainbow trout in Indiana. You can keep any size you catch, as long as you stay within the daily bag limit.
Do I need a fishing license to fish for rainbow trout in Pottawattamie Park?
Yes, a valid Indiana freshwater fishing license is required to fish for rainbow trout. Make sure your license is current before heading out.
